This subcontract for the Inscription House Apartments Phase 4 project involves providing rough carpentry, structural wood framing, and wall and roof sheathing. The scope of work includes the installation of Exterior Exposure 1 plywood sheathing and wall framing, with a requirement to apply EPA-registered borate treatment if specific moisture content limits are exceeded. The final deliverable is the completed building shell and framing. The opportunity is managed by the Department of Health and Human Services Division of Engineering Services in Seattle, with the work being performed in Tonalea, Arizona. This is an ISBEE set-aside for Indian Small Business Economic Enterprises under NAICS code 238130. The response deadline for this solicitation is September 24, 2026.
